JetBlue Airways and Spirit Airlines on Friday appealed a federal judge's ruling issued earlier this week that blocks the two carriers' planned merger on antitrust grounds. JetBlue had planned to buy Spirit for $3.8 billion in a deal struck in the summer of 2022. JetBlue Airways told staff this week that it will cut some routes and service as it struggles to return to profitability and grapples with the fallout of its blocked plan to buy Spirit Airlines. JetBlue said it will stop flying from New York's John F. Kennedy Airport to Portland, Oregon, and to San Jose, California, and from Westchester, New York, and Martha's Vineyard, according to an internal memo, which was reviewed by CNBC. Spirit Airlines is on shaky footing after JetBlue Airways' proposed $3.8 billion takeover of the budget carrier was blocked by a federal judge this week. Industry-watchers say the carrier could be forced to cut its already low fares even more. Some Wall Street analysts argue the discount carrier could have to restructure, if not liquidate. Shares of Spirit Airlines fell about 23% Wednesday, its second day of double-digit losses, after a judge blocked its proposed merger with JetBlue Airways. Spirit is down roughly 60% since the decision blocking its $3.8 billion acquisition by JetBlue was handed down Tuesday, citing reduced competition.
